Apple Cake From Grandma Recipe


Apple Cake From Grandma Recipe
This is a favorite apple cake in my family. The recipe originated from "A Passion for Desserts" by Emily Luchetti

Ingredients
  • 5 Tbsp. plus 1/4 cup sugar
  • 1 cup All-pur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 large egg
  • 2 Tbsp. milk
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 2 ounces (4 Tbsp./1/2 stick/56 grams) unsalted butter, softened
  • 2 medium Golden Delicious apples (about 1 pound. 3 ounces)
  • 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on

Directions
  1.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 C).
  2. Coat the bottom of a 10-inch cast-iron skillet with cooking oil spray.
  3. Sprinkle 2 tablespoons of the sugar over the bottom of the pan.
  4. Sift together the flour, salt and baking powder. In a small bowl, whisk together the egg, milk and vanilla.
  5. In another bowl, mix together the butter and the 1/4 cup of sugar until light. One minute with a stand mixer or two minutes with a hand held mixer.
  6. By hand, stir in one-third of the flour mixture and then one-third of the milk mixture just until mixed.
  7. Add the remaining flour and milk in 2 additions.
  8. Spread the batter in the skillet. It will be thick and a little sticky.
  9. If difficult to spread, wet the back of a spoon or ends of your fingers to push the batter out to the edges.
  10. Peel and core the apples.
  11. Cut them in slices 1/8 inch thick.
  12. Starting from the outer edge of the cake, arrange the apples in concentric circles, slightly overlapping over the top of the batter, completely covering it. In a small bowl, mix together the remaining 3 tablespoons sugar with the cinnamon and sprinkle it over the apples.
  13. Bake until a skewer inserted in the middle comes out clean, 20 to 25 minutes.
  14. Let cool for 10 minutes.
  15. Loosen the edges and bottom of the cake, from the pan using a large metal spatula.
  16. Place a large plate on the top of the cake.
  17. Invert the pan and plate together, then remove the pan.
  18. Place another plate on top of the cake and invert again so it is right-side up.
  19. Makes 8 servings.
